Descrizione Lavoro - Technical Staff - Remote Sensing Scientist


The Applied Space Systems Group develops environmental monitoring electro-optical and microwave sensor systems for remote sensing applications.  The group supports partners in US Government organizations as well as industry.  Activities include development of electro-optical and microwave sensors; system and architecture analysis; signal processing, data analysis and algorithm development.  The group seeks physicists, astronomers, applied mathematicians, electrical engineers, computer engineers, and those with related experience who have interest in developing cutting edge space remote sensing technologies for future missions.


Job Description

Group 97, The Applied Space Systems Group, seeks a remote sensing scientist to join our team, focused on supporting the application of advanced electro-optical sensor systems.  The successful candidate will be part of a team with imaging and data scientists as well as hardware and software engineers to prototype, operate and analyze the performance of highly integrated sensor systems for terrestrial and space applications.
